В Excel объединение функций – это один из самых мощных инструментов для ускорения анализа данных и автоматизации процессов. Простое использование одной функции может не покрыть все потребности задачи, поэтому комбинирование нескольких формул позволяет создавать более сложные и точные вычисления. Чтобы эффективно работать с Excel, необходимо понимать, как правильно сочетать различные функции, обеспечивая максимальную гибкость и точность расчетов.
Например, сочетание функций IF, AND и OR позволяет строить сложные логические условия, что крайне полезно при работе с условиями и фильтрами. Такие комбинации помогают не только проверять несколько параметров одновременно, но и принимать решение на основе комплексных проверок. Еще одной часто используемой связкой является VLOOKUP с IFERROR, которая позволяет проводить поиск значений с автоматической обработкой ошибок, обеспечивая более чистые и понятные результаты.
Понимание того, как объединять математические и статистические функции, такие как SUM, AVERAGE и COUNTIF, открывает возможности для создания мощных формул для анализа данных. Например, использование SUMPRODUCT вместе с IF помогает быстро вычислять суммы, основанные на множественных условиях, что значительно ускоряет анализ больших объемов данных. Эффективность таких комбинированных функций в бизнес-аналитике или финансовых расчетах трудно переоценить.
Использование функции СЦЕПИТЬ для объединения данных из нескольких ячеек
Функция СЦЕПИТЬ в Excel позволяет комбинировать значения из нескольких ячеек в одну строку. Она полезна, например, для создания полных адресов из отдельных данных (улица, город, индекс), а также для формирования объединённых данных из разных столбцов.
Для использования функции СЦЕПИТЬ необходимо указать значения или ссылки на ячейки, которые требуется объединить. Формула выглядит так: =СЦЕПИТЬ(текст1; текст2; ...)
. В качестве аргументов могут выступать как текстовые значения, так и ссылки на ячейки.
Если нужно вставить разделитель между объединяемыми данными, например, пробел или запятую, это можно сделать, добавив текстовый аргумент с нужным символом. Пример: =СЦЕПИТЬ(A1; " "; B1)
объединяет значения ячеек A1 и B1 с пробелом между ними.
Функция СЦЕПИТЬ полезна в ситуациях, когда необходимо сформировать динамическую строку, которая зависит от содержимого других ячеек. Например, если в ячейке A1 содержится имя, а в ячейке B1 – фамилия, с помощью формулы =СЦЕПИТЬ(A1; " "; B1)
можно быстро объединить их в одну строку.
В Excel 2016 и более поздних версиях функция СЦЕПИТЬ была заменена на функцию СЦЕПИТЬСТРОКИ. Однако, несмотря на наличие более нового аналога, многие пользователи по-прежнему используют классическую функцию СЦЕПИТЬ, так как она является более знакомой и доступной.
Также важно помнить, что функция СЦЕПИТЬ не поддерживает возможность работы с массивами данных напрямую. Для более сложных задач объединения данных, когда необходимо работать с массивами, предпочтительнее использовать функции, такие как ТЕКСТ.Объединить или СЦЕПИТЬСТРОКИ, которые обеспечивают более гибкие возможности для работы с множественными строками и диапазонами.
Как совместить функции ВПР и ЕСЛИ для поиска значений с условиями
Для решения задач поиска значений с дополнительными условиями в Excel можно объединить функции ВПР и ЕСЛИ. Эта комбинация позволяет искать данные в таблицах и применять различные логические проверки в зависимости от найденных значений.
Функция ВПР (VLOOKUP) выполняет поиск значения в первом столбце таблицы и возвращает значение из другой ячейки той же строки. Функция ЕСЛИ (IF) используется для проверки условий и выполнения действий в зависимости от результата этой проверки. Объединив эти функции, можно задать поиск значений с учетом определенных условий.
Рассмотрим пример: у вас есть таблица с данными о продажах, где необходимо искать значения по определенному условию, например, если сумма продажи больше определенной величины.
Пример формулы:
=ЕСЛИ(ВПР(A2;Данные!$A$1:$C$10;2;ЛОЖЬ)>10000;"Высокая продажа";"Низкая продажа")
Здесь:
- ВПР(A2;Данные!$A$1:$C$10;2;ЛОЖЬ) ищет значение из ячейки A2 в первом столбце диапазона Данные!$A$1:$C$10 и возвращает соответствующее значение из второго столбца.
Этот подход позволяет искать значения и одновременно применять логические проверки для дальнейшей обработки данных. Вы можете легко адаптировать формулу для других условий, например, для разных диапазонов значений или дополнительных параметров.
При использовании ВПР с ЕСЛИ важно помнить о нескольких моментах:
- Функция ВПР всегда ищет значение в первом столбце диапазона, поэтому правильно выбирайте столбец для поиска.
- Логическое условие в функции ЕСЛИ должно быть корректно настроено для того, чтобы результат был точным и понятным.
- Если функция ВПР не находит искомое значение, она возвращает ошибку #Н/Д, и вам нужно учесть это в условии функции ЕСЛИ, например, с помощью функции ЕСЛИОШИБКА.
Комбинируя эти функции, вы получаете мощный инструмент для гибкой работы с данными, который помогает находить нужные значения и делать дальнейший анализ с учетом разных условий.
Объединение функций СУММ и ЕСЛИ для подсчета данных по условиям
Функция СУММ позволяет подсчитывать сумму чисел, но в сочетании с функцией ЕСЛИ она становится мощным инструментом для подсчета данных, удовлетворяющих определённым условиям. С помощью объединения этих двух функций можно не только суммировать значения, но и фильтровать их по заданным критериям, например, по категории товара или по определённой дате.
Основная структура объединённой функции выглядит так: СУММ(ЕСЛИ(условие, диапазон_суммирования))
. Для правильной работы этой комбинации важно помнить о следующем: если используете её в одной ячейке, необходимо завершить формулу с помощью комбинации клавиш Ctrl + Shift + Enter
, так как это формула массива.
Пример использования: допустим, у вас есть таблица с данными о продажах товаров, и вам нужно посчитать общую сумму продаж для конкретного товара. Формула будет выглядеть так: СУММ(ЕСЛИ(A2:A100="Товар1", B2:B100))
, где A2:A100
– это столбец с названиями товаров, а B2:B100
– столбец с суммой продаж. Эта формула суммирует все продажи товара «Товар1».
Можно усложнить задачу, например, добавить несколько условий. Для этого используется функция ЕСЛИ с несколькими аргументами, которая может проверять несколько критериев одновременно. Например, чтобы подсчитать продажи товара «Товар1» за определённый месяц, формула будет выглядеть так: СУММ(ЕСЛИ((A2:A100="Товар1")*(C2:C100="Январь"), B2:B100))
, где C2:C100
– это столбец с месяцами. Такая формула учитывает только те продажи, которые соответствуют обеим условиям.
При работе с числовыми данными также возможно использовать операторы сравнения, такие как «больше», «меньше», «равно». Например, для подсчёта сумм, где продажи превышают определённое значение, можно использовать следующую формулу: СУММ(ЕСЛИ(B2:B100>1000, B2:B100))
, которая просуммирует только те значения, которые больше 1000.
В сочетании с функцией СУММ и ЕСЛИ можно также применять различные математические функции, что открывает ещё более широкие возможности для анализа данных. Например, если необходимо подсчитать среднее значение продаж, то можно использовать функцию СРЗНАЧ в комбинации с ЕСЛИ, чтобы учитывать только те данные, которые соответствуют условиям.
Таким образом, объединение функций СУММ и ЕСЛИ позволяет гибко анализировать данные и получать точные результаты, удовлетворяющие различным условиям, что делает этот подход неотъемлемой частью работы с большими массивами информации в Excel.
Использование функций ЛЕВСИМВ и ПРАВСИМВ для извлечения части данных из строки
Функции ЛЕВСИМВ и ПРАВСИМВ в Excel позволяют извлекать определенные части данных из строки текста, что часто используется при анализе информации или при подготовке данных для дальнейших расчетов. Эти функции помогают работать с текстовыми строками, извлекая символы с начала или конца строки, в зависимости от задачи.
Функция ЛЕВСИМВ извлекает заданное количество символов с начала строки. Синтаксис функции выглядит следующим образом:
ЛЕВСИМВ(текст; количество_символов)
где текст – это строка, из которой необходимо извлечь данные, а количество_символов – это количество символов, которые будут извлечены начиная с первого. Например, если в ячейке A1 содержится текст «12345ABCDE», то формула =ЛЕВСИМВ(A1; 5) вернет «12345».
Для извлечения данных с конца строки используется функция ПРАВСИМВ. Она работает аналогично функции ЛЕВСИМВ, но извлекает символы с правой стороны строки. Синтаксис этой функции следующий:
ПРАВСИМВ(текст; количество_символов)
где текст – это строка, а количество_символов – количество символов, которые нужно извлечь с конца строки. Например, для строки «12345ABCDE» формула =ПРАВСИМВ(A1; 3) вернет «CDE».
Комбинированное использование функций ЛЕВСИМВ и ПРАВСИМВ позволяет эффективно разделять строку на части по определенным признакам. Например, если требуется извлечь определенную часть строки, где начальная и конечная часть имеют фиксированную длину, можно использовать обе функции в одной формуле. Например, для строки «12345ABCDE» можно извлечь 5 символов с начала и 3 символа с конца с помощью формулы:
ЛЕВСИМВ(A1; 5) & ПРАВСИМВ(A1; 3)
Это позволит объединить первую и последнюю части строки в одну.
Важно помнить, что обе функции требуют указания точного числа символов для извлечения, что делает их удобными в ситуациях, когда структура строки заранее известна. Если необходимо извлечь часть строки, основываясь на поиске определенного символа или подстроки, то для этого лучше использовать другие функции, такие как НАЙТИ или ПОИСК, которые могут быть объединены с ЛЕВСИМВ и ПРАВСИМВ для более гибкого решения задачи.
Комбинирование функций НАЙТИ и ЗАМЕНИТЬ для обработки текста в ячейках
Функции НАЙТИ и ЗАМЕНИТЬ в Excel можно эффективно комбинировать для решения различных задач по обработке текста в ячейках. Эти функции позволяют не только находить нужные символы или подстроки, но и заменять их, что открывает широкие возможности для автоматизации работы с данными.
Функция НАЙТИ возвращает позицию первого вхождения строки в другую строку. Например, =НАЙТИ(«о», «Москва») вернет значение 2, так как «о» находится на втором месте в слове «Москва». Эта информация может быть полезна для определения, существует ли конкретный текст в ячейке или для дальнейших манипуляций с ним.
Для выполнения замены символов или подстрок в Excel используется функция ЗАМЕНИТЬ. С ее помощью можно заменить часть строки на другую строку, указав позицию начала и количество символов для замены. Например, =ЗАМЕНИТЬ(«Москва», 1, 1, «М») заменит первую букву «М» на букву «М», не изменяя ничего, но это демонстрирует принцип работы функции.
Комбинирование этих функций открывает возможности для более сложных манипуляций с текстом. Например, можно использовать НАЙТИ для определения позиции конкретного символа или подстроки, а затем на основе этой позиции заменить текст с помощью функции ЗАМЕНИТЬ. Для реализации этого подхода можно использовать вложенные функции, например, следующую формулу:
=ЗАМЕНИТЬ(A1; 1; НАЙТИ(" ", A1)-1; "Новое слово")
Данная формула заменяет все символы до первого пробела на «Новое слово», предполагая, что в ячейке A1 содержится текст с пробелами. Важно отметить, что с помощью комбинирования этих функций можно заменять не только первые вхождения, но и работать с текстом по определённым позициям.
Кроме того, использование НАЙТИ и ЗАМЕНИТЬ помогает эффективно очищать данные, заменяя ненужные символы или исправляя ошибки в текстах без необходимости вручную редактировать каждую ячейку. Например, можно автоматизировать процесс замены всех дефисов в номерах телефонов на пробелы или замену старых значений на актуальные в крупных наборах данных.
Таким образом, комбинированное использование функций НАЙТИ и ЗАМЕНИТЬ значительно расширяет функциональность Excel для обработки текстовых данных, автоматизируя процессы, которые ранее требовали бы вручную редактирования.
Вопрос-ответ:
Как можно объединить несколько функций в Excel для вычислений?
Для того чтобы объединить несколько функций в Excel, нужно использовать их совместно в одной ячейке. Это достигается путем введения функции внутри другой. Например, можно комбинировать функцию SUM (для суммы) с функцией IF (для проверки условий). Пример: =SUM(IF(A1:A10>10, A1:A10, 0)) — эта формула сначала проверяет, какие значения больше 10, а затем суммирует только те из них. Важно помнить, что некоторые функции могут требовать использования дополнительных символов, таких как запятые или скобки для корректной работы.
Можно ли объединить функции в Excel так, чтобы они работали по цепочке?
Да, в Excel можно создавать цепочку из функций, чтобы одна функция передавала свои результаты в другую. Например, можно использовать функцию VLOOKUP (для поиска данных) в сочетании с IF (для проверки условий). Например, формула =IF(VLOOKUP(A1, B1:C10, 2, FALSE)>50, «Да», «Нет») сначала ищет значение в таблице через VLOOKUP, а затем проверяет, больше ли оно 50, и в зависимости от результата выводит «Да» или «Нет». Таким образом, результат одной функции служит входными данными для другой.
Как объединить функции для работы с текстовыми данными в Excel?
В Excel можно объединять текстовые функции, чтобы выполнять более сложные задачи. Например, можно использовать CONCATENATE (или новый оператор &) для объединения текста, а затем применить функции TRIM (удаление лишних пробелов) и UPPER (перевод в верхний регистр). Например, формула =UPPER(TRIM(CONCATENATE(A1, » «, B1))) объединяет два текста из ячеек A1 и B1, убирает лишние пробелы и переводит итог в верхний регистр. Такое комбинирование позволяет работать с данными более гибко и удобно.
Как объединить функции для анализа данных с условиями в Excel?
Для анализа данных с условиями в Excel можно комбинировать такие функции, как IF, COUNTIF и SUMIF. Например, с помощью COUNTIF можно посчитать количество значений, которые удовлетворяют определенному условию, а SUMIF — подсчитать сумму значений, которые соответствуют заданному критерию. Формула =SUMIF(A1:A10, «>100») посчитает сумму всех значений в диапазоне A1:A10, которые больше 100. Таким образом, комбинация этих функций позволяет легко анализировать данные в зависимости от определенных условий.
Можно ли использовать несколько функций одновременно для обработки числовых данных в Excel?
Да, в Excel можно комбинировать несколько функций для обработки числовых данных. Например, можно использовать функцию AVERAGE для вычисления среднего значения, а затем применить функцию ROUND для округления результата. Формула =ROUND(AVERAGE(A1:A10), 2) сначала вычислит среднее значение по диапазону A1:A10, а затем округлит результат до двух знаков после запятой. Таким образом, можно использовать функции в комбинации для более точной обработки и анализа числовых данных.